莱州湾海湾扇贝养殖区海水中悬浮颗粒的动态变化   总被引:3,自引:0,他引:3  
1997年10月和1998年6月,在莱州湾两个主要海湾扇贝养殖区-芙蓉岛海区和金城海区,各定点进行了24h连续观测和取样,并在实验室内分析了总颗粒物(TPM)、颗粒有机物(POM)和叶绿素α的含量。结果表明,6月份金城海区的颗粒有机物和叶绿素α的含量均高于荚蓉岛海区;在10月份,芙蓉岛海区颗粒有机物的含量高于金城海区,但其叶绿素α的含量却低于金城海区,表明金城海区颗粒有机物的质量高于芙蓉岛海区。  相似文献

A primary study on palynofacies, which concerns the paleoenvironments from the sight of association of sedimentary organic matter preserved in sedimentary rocks, is conducted for a Late Jurassic-Cretaceous succession at Gyangzê, southern Tibet. Two palynofacies are recognized, which are formed in different sedimentary environments. The one in the pelagic is infertile in organic productivity and monotonous in component and is dominated by AOMA, while the other, being closely bound up with the slope, is characterized by abundant black phytoclasts that are possibly of algal origin and contains much AOM. The influence of terrestrial input is clear in the latter, for particles generated from terrestrial plants are common. A number of fossil spores and pollen together with some dinocysts are discovered, but they are normally in a bad condition of preservation. Nevertheless, this convinces us that the late Jurassic-Cretaceous succession in the Gyangzê area has a potential for palynological stratigraphy. We have also proved that the volume of PM can achieve similar results in presenting the productivity of organic matter as the weight of TOC does. This technique is much easier in the laboratory than that we do with TOC.  相似文献

于1997年6月-1998年5月用现场方法测定了烟台四十里湾海区总颗粒物质(TPM)、颗粒有机物(POM)现存量和栉孔扇贝同化率(AE)周年变化,并分析栉孔扇贝同化率与海区温度、盐度、TPM和POM的关系。结果表明,(1)整个海区TPM现存量秋季最高,其次为春季和冬季,夏季最低;海区POM含量变化不大,在1.34-1.65mg/L之间;栉孔扇贝同化率在春、夏、秋三了较高,冬季较低,其中在秋末冬初(  相似文献

Based on the Theory of Porous Media (TPM), a mathematical model of a two-dimensional incompressible fluid-saturated elastic soil is established, and the periodic boundary conditions are presented to analyze the transient dynamic response of this soil under a moving cyclic loading. The differential quadrature method (DQM) and the second-order backward difference scheme are applied to discretize the governing equations on the spatial and temporal domains, respectively. As application, a typical two-dimensional wave-induced transient problem with a seabed of finite thickness is analyzed, and the numerical results are compared with the analytical results presented in the present work. In addition, a transient dynamic response of fluid-saturated soil under limit moving vehicle loadings is studied. The effects of the velocity of vehicle and the volume fraction on the settlement and the pore water pressure are studied.  相似文献

The numerical simulation of liquefaction phenomena in fluid-saturated porous materials within a continuum-mechanical framework is the aim of this contribution. This is achieved by exploiting the Theory of Porous Media (TPM) together with thermodynamically consistent elasto-viscoplastic constitutive laws. Additionally, the Finite Element Method (FEM) besides monolithic time-stepping schemes is used for the numerical treatment of the arising coupled multi-field problem. Within an isothermal and geometrically linear framework, the focus is on fully saturated biphasic materials with incompressible and immiscible phases. Thus, one is concerned with the class of volumetrically coupled problems involving a potentially strong coupling of the solid and fluid momentum balance equations and the algebraic incompressibility constraint. Applying the suggested material model, two important liquefaction-related incidents in porous media dynamics, namely the flow liquefaction and the cyclic mobility, are addressed, and a seismic soil–structure interaction problem to reveal the aforementioned two behaviors in saturated soils is introduced.  相似文献

提出了可信密码模块软件栈的兼容性设计方案,采用软件工程中的策略模式,在软件栈TSS基础上内置兼容解释器,对应用和TCM的交互进行数据流解析以及数据结构和授权协议的转换,为上层应用提供统一的服务接口。该方案使得基于TPM开发的可信应用不需修改或只需少量修改就可以应用于TCM。测试表明,可信密码模块软件栈完成了应用层调用可信功能的透明转换,实现了应用兼容。  相似文献

In this paper, Split Markov Process (SMP) is developed to assess one‐step‐ahead variation of daily rainfall at a rain gauge station. SMP is an advancement of general Markov Process and specially developed for probabilistic assessment of change in daily rainfall magnitude. The approach is based on a first‐order Markov chain to simulate daily rainfall variation at a point through state/sub‐state transitional probability matrix (TPM). The state/sub‐state TPM is based on the historical transitions from a particular state to a particular sub‐state, which is the basic difference between SMP and general Markov Process. The cumulative state/sub‐state TPM is represented in a contour plot at different probability levels. The developed cumulative state/sub‐state TPM is used to assess the possible range of rainfall in next time step, in a probabilistic sense. Application of SMP is investigated for daily rainfall at four rain gauge stations – Khandwa, Jabalpur, Sambalpur, and Puri, located at various parts in India. There are 99 years of record available out of which approximately 80% of data are used for calibration, and 20% of data are used to assess the performance. Thus, 80 years of daily monsoon rainfall is used to develop the state/sub‐state TPM, and 19 years data are used to investigate its performance. Model performance is assessed in terms of hit rate (HR), false alarm rate (FAR), and percentage captured. It is found that percentage captured is maximum for Khandwa (70%) and minimum for Sambalpur (44%) whereas hit rate is maximum for Sambalpur and minimum for Khandwa (73%). FAR is around 30% or below for Jabalpur, Sambalpur, and Puri. FAR is maximum for Khandwa (37%). Overall, the assessed range, particularly the upper limit, provides a quantification possible extreme value in the next time step, which is a very useful information to tackle the extreme events, such as flooding, water logging and so on. SmartMK:基于TPM的可信多内核操作系统架构   总被引:1,自引:0,他引:1  
提出了一个多内核架构SmartMK来支撑不同安全等级和类别的应用.基于TPM和新的CPU安全技术,实现了多内核之间的强隔离与安全通信机制,以软硬件协同保护的方式实现安全的操作系统运行环境.在SmartMK架构上提出了分层次的强制访问控制方模型,进一步降低复杂环境中的访问控制复杂度.性能测试和实际应用都表明,SmartMK能够有效加强系统的安全性,同时很好地保证了系统的运行效率.  相似文献
